As a valued colleague on our team, you will, under limited supervision, conduct theoretical and empirical research with public and proprietary data in all areas of mortgage finance business, including mortgage products and securities, borrower behavior, investment and hedging strategies, residential property valuation, macroeconomic models including housing prices and interest rate, financial valuation of finance assets and derivatives, economic capital, and stress testing.

THE IMPACT YOU WILL MAKE
The Enterprise Model Risk - Quantitative Modeling - Senior Associate role will offer you the flexibility to make each day your own, while working alongside people who care so that you can deliver on the following responsibilities:

Fannie Mae seeks Quantitative Modeler

  • Conduct theoretical and empirical research using public and proprietary data in all areas of mortgage finance business, including mortgage products and securities, borrower behavior, investment and hedging strategies, residential property valuation, and macroeconomic models.
  • Develop model risk reporting and analytical applications using Python, and other open-source technologies.
  • Contribute to an Agile development process for continuous iteration and improvement of the technological roadmap for model risk monitoring and information management.
  • Employ version control, automated testing, and thoughtful objected oriented design to develop resilient and scalable applications.
  • Develop, implement, and manage robust data models for querying and delivering analytical insights to oversight and model development staff on SQL and/or No-SQL databases.
  • Utilize UI/UX best practices to develop applications that inform stakeholders on relevant model risk data.
  • Apply mathematical, statistical, and econometric techniques to provide innovative, thorough, and practical solutions to support business strategies and initiatives.
  • Utilize data mining and statistical techniques to develop analytic insights, sound hypotheses, and informed recommendations.
  • Identify opportunities to apply quantitative methods to improve business performance.
  • Ensure modeling projects are conducted in accordance with established company policies and generally-accepted modeling practices.
  • Develop and implement validation strategies and assess the quality and risk of model methodologies, outputs, and processes.
  • Mentor less experienced team members.
